Man, 66, hit by van crossing Scarborough street

The pedestrian was rushed to hospital with life-threatening injuries

A 66-year-old man is fighting for his life after he was hit by a van while crossing a street in Scarborough on Friday afternoon.

Toronto police say officers responded to the collision involving a pedestrian in the area of Lawrence Ave. E. and Bellamy Rd. N. shortly after 2 p.m.

A 61-year-old man driving a red van made a left turn from westbound Lawrence to southbound Bellamy and struck the senior citizen, Const. Sinderela Chung said in a statement released Saturday.

She said the driver remained at the scene following the collision.

“The pedestrian was transported to hospital with life-threatening injuries,” Chung said.

No further details have been released.

“The investigation is ongoing by members of Traffic Services,” Chung said.

Police are asking local residents, businesses, and drivers who may have security or dash camera footage of the area, or incident, to contact investigators.
